Buying Guide for the Best Ultrasonic Mouse Repeller

Choosing the right ultrasonic mouse repeller can be a bit overwhelming with the variety of options available. The key is to understand the main features and specifications that will best suit your needs. Ultrasonic mouse repellers work by emitting high-frequency sound waves that are unpleasant to rodents, driving them away from your home or property. To make an informed decision, you should consider the following key specifications and how they align with your specific requirements.
Frequency RangeThe frequency range of an ultrasonic mouse repeller refers to the range of sound frequencies it emits. This is important because different frequencies can be more or less effective at repelling different types of rodents. Typically, a frequency range between 20 kHz and 65 kHz is effective for most household rodents. If you have a specific rodent problem, you might want to choose a device that targets the frequency range most effective for that species. For general use, a broader frequency range is usually better.
Coverage AreaThe coverage area indicates the amount of space the ultrasonic waves can cover. This is crucial because you need to ensure that the device can cover the entire area where you have a rodent problem. Coverage areas can range from a few hundred square feet to several thousand square feet. For small rooms or single areas, a device with a smaller coverage area will suffice. For larger spaces or multiple rooms, you may need a device with a larger coverage area or multiple devices to ensure full coverage.
Power SourceUltrasonic mouse repellers can be powered by batteries, plugged into an electrical outlet, or even solar-powered. The power source is important for convenience and placement flexibility. Battery-powered devices are portable and can be placed anywhere, but they require regular battery changes. Plug-in devices are more convenient for continuous use but need to be near an outlet. Solar-powered devices are eco-friendly and ideal for outdoor use but depend on sunlight availability. Choose the power source that best fits your usage scenario.
Adjustable SettingsSome ultrasonic mouse repellers come with adjustable settings, allowing you to change the frequency or intensity of the sound waves. This feature is important because it lets you customize the device to be more effective for your specific rodent problem. Adjustable settings can also help prevent rodents from becoming accustomed to a single frequency. If you have a persistent or varied rodent problem, a device with adjustable settings can be more effective in the long run.
Safety FeaturesSafety features ensure that the ultrasonic mouse repeller is safe for use around humans and pets. Some devices are designed to be pet-friendly, emitting frequencies that are inaudible to dogs and cats but still effective against rodents. It's important to check if the device is safe for your specific pets. Additionally, some devices have features like automatic shut-off or overheat protection to ensure safe operation. If you have pets or children, prioritize devices with these safety features.
Additional FeaturesSome ultrasonic mouse repellers come with additional features such as night lights, pest control for other insects, or even air purifiers. These features can add extra value and convenience. For example, a night light can be useful in dark areas, and a device that also repels insects can provide broader pest control. Consider what additional features might be beneficial for your situation and choose a device that offers those extras.
